Lecturer

Member of the Department of Biological Sciences Faculty, since October, 2021. Over 6 years experience of teaching Biology at college level and O Levels at renowned institutions of Lahore. 6 years of research experience in agricultural and horticultural development, in international and national collaboration with Global Landcare, John Innes Centre,  England,  National Institute of Agrobiological Sciences, Japan, Parks and Horticulture Authority Lahore, Ayub Agricultural Research Institute, National Institute for Biotechnology and Genetic Engineering and Nuclear Institute for Agriculture and Biology, Faisalabad and Pakistan Atomic Energy Commission. Recipient of Australian Landcare International grant-2021, for a project titled “Establishing Roof-top home gardens for quality and low-cost organic vegetables and fruits”. Received Sub-examiner training from Punjab Education Foundation (PEF), Lahore, and teacher training certificates from  Cambridge Learning for Schools. Conducted teacher’s training on BISE Exam Preparation, Paper Presentation & Better Classroom Management Strategies in St. Anthony’s College Lahore, FCCU, and numerous educational institutions in Punjab, Pakistan.
